Listing start time

I have just opened an account and listed my first item for auction.  I always thought I would be able to set a start time but this option failed to show, am I right or wrong in my assumption.  Thank you

Listing start time

To schedule your listing: On the Sell your item form, scroll to the Choose a format and price section Select Scheduled start time option, and then select the date and time you want your listing to begin. (If you don't see this option, click the Add or remove options link at the top of the section. Then click the Scheduled start check box, and click the Save button) Complete the Sell your item form. Review and submit your listing.

Listing start time

If you scroll down to where you select whether you want to use auction or fixed price (under the heading Select Format and Price), there will be a check box at the bottom there where you can schedule your listing to start when you want it to start. If for some reason it isn't there, scroll all the way back up to the top and click on the switch to advanced tool option. Ignore the warning and select switch. On the next screen there will be a link to your listing if you have already created it. Click on that and it will open a new listing format.

 

The option to scedule should appear under the Choose a Format and Price heading under the big description box about halfway down the page. If it's not there, click on the add or remove items link next to the format and price heading and tick the box that says scheduled start. That should do the trick!
